A town in Kitakanbara County in northern Niigata Prefecture. It borders Shibata City, occupies the Kaji River basin, and faces the Sea of Japan. The town cultivates rice, fruits, and vegetables, and is prolific in producing Nijisseiki pears and grapes. Niigata East Port was built in 1969, and a thermal power plant and an oil storage facility are located here. Area: 37.58 km2 .
